Have
you heard the story of Joanne Gillespie? "She had been
diagnosed with a cancerous brain tumor and given six months
to live. But she became a celebrity in England, where she
lived, because of her refusal to give in, and she wrote two
books about her fight before she succumbed to her illness.
She was fifteen years old. Some of her inner qualities shone
through in a poem she wrote that was read by her twelve-year-old
sister at her funeral:
THANKS
Thanks
God for listening to me all those times I wanted to talk to
you. Even though I go on a bit.
Thanks
for helping me when I asked. And thanks for laughter.
Thank
you God for Michael Jackson, loud music, ballet and snowflakes.
For strawberries
and doctors and snowmen and scarecrows. And even some dentists!
Thank
you for families and friends and all the things I don't understand.
Though some may be painful, like war and death and hunger.
I still thank you because you are giving me the chance to
help others.
And when
it is time to put away all things you gave me, please God
don't let me say "Why?" Let me say "Thanks."
--Let
Your Life So Shine, pp. 85, 86.
